Heritability explains fast-learning chicks

Friday, August 31, 2018 - 08:00 in Psychology & Sociology

Both genetic and environmental factors explain cognitive traits, shows a new study carried out on red junglefowl. Researchers at Linköping University in Sweden have shown that the ability of fowl to cope with difficult learning tasks is heritable, while their optimism can be explained by environmental factors.
